Output ec31c448d82876ca77ae693a622cc7363ba85cdd37f3d47284e4df257ec761b1:0

value
21564400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b99d2de06ad665deb402ad8c265daaef7eb372b4 OP_EQUAL
address
3JcTE2z96PnupSvB5dQuXKkxRvia46T4CV
transaction
ec31c448d82876ca77ae693a622cc7363ba85cdd37f3d47284e4df257ec761b1
spent
true